Output 406269036d71193156df44535de9da80c9a6fb898623fcc9dab021904566e1e8:1

value
1781431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f6ff9fe71d8ac20637dc54796277f8fb8d631a0 OP_EQUAL
address
37USdttKFdevnC99yWxoytcGFJeRLuzkZD
transaction
406269036d71193156df44535de9da80c9a6fb898623fcc9dab021904566e1e8
spent
true